Ipswich Town: The Underdog Story

When you think of Ipswich Town, you're likely thinking of a club steeped in history and tradition. They've had their moments of glory, including winning the FA Cup in 1978 and the UEFA Cup in 1981. But, let’s be real, they've also seen their fair share of struggles and have spent a significant amount of time outside the Premier League. Currently, they are making strides to re-establish themselves as a formidable team.

Leicester City: The Premier League Veteran

Leicester City! Who can forget their fairytale Premier League title win in 2016? It was one of the most remarkable achievements in football history, defying all odds. But even beyond that incredible season, Leicester has consistently been a competitive team in the Premier League, known for its dynamic play and talented players.

Pakistan: The Cricket Powerhouse

Now, let's throw a curveball into the mix – Pakistan, but not the football team; we're talking about the cricket team! Obviously, this is where the comparison gets really fun and hypothetical. Pakistan is a nation renowned for its passion for cricket and its rich history in the sport. They've produced some of the greatest cricketers of all time and have a fan base that is second to none.
